In support of the International Society for Animal Rights’ National Homeless Pet Day, Camp Bow Wow Agoura Hills will be hosting a Dog Adoption event on Saturday, August 20, from 12noon to 3pm with Labs and Buddies Rescue, a no-kill rescue committed to saving all types of Labrador Retrievers, Lab mixes and other mixed breeds.

“When you love dogs the way we do, you want to make every effort to find all homeless dogs a loving, safe home,” said Paul Berkovitz, owner and director of Camp Bow Wow Agoura Hills, the premiere provider of doggie day and overnight camp.  “We greatly admire the work that Labs and Buddies Rescue is doing and encourage everyone in our community who is considering getting a new dog to
visit Labs and Buddies Rescue first.”

Labs and Buddies Rescue, although passionate about black Labrador Retrievers, helps dogs of all breeds, colors and
ages.  Founded by Laura Portillo, Labs and Buddies Rescue believes that every dog deserves a loving, caring family
where they can show their owners the love, loyalty and the amazing companionship dogs provide.

“We’re a volunteer run organization,” said Portilla, “Our typical adoption fee is $300 which covers our costs to make sure that every dog we rescue is vaccinated and
sterilized and receives any additional medical attention it requires. All proceeds from the dog adoptions go towards the rescue, medical care and boarding of the dogs.”

People considering dog adoption can visit Labs and Buddies online at http://labsandbuddies.org to view the dogs available for adoption and to complete an adoption form
online.
